Summary:

Under the supervision of a pharmacist, fills medication orders, pre-packages, compounds pharmaceuticals, refills stock supplies, delivers medication and performs various clerical duties as required

Responsibilities:

  • Meets and demonstrates competency in all Pharmacy Technician I requirements.
  • Successfully completes required training and maintains competency in one or more of the following areas:
    • Sterile medication preparation
    • Pediatric sterile and nonsterile medication preparation
    • Controlled substance inventory, distribution, and disposal
  • Ensures compliance with the department’s Controlled Substances Compliance Plan.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or GED 
  • Certified Pharmacy Technician-PTCB
  • Or, Certified Pharmacy Technician-NHA
  • Specialized, short-term training in the areas of pharmacy law, practice standards, terminology, pharmacy math, drug preparation, dosage forms, and trade/generic names.
  • Successful completion of PHS Sterile Products Compounding Competency
  • At least one year of experience in pharmacy or completion of an accredited pharmacy technician training program.

About Presbyterian Healthcare Services

Presbyterian exists to improve the health of patients, members, and the communities we serve. We are locally owned, not-for-profit healthcare system of nine hospitals, a statewide health plan and a growing multi-specialty medical group. Founded in New Mexico in 1908, we are the state's largest private employer with nearly 14,000 employees - including more than 1600 providers and nearly 4,700 nurses.

Our health plan serves more than 580,000 members statewide and offers Medicare Advantage, Medicaid (Centennial Care) and Commercial health plans.
